The Age of Disclosure is a 2025 documentary directed by Dan Farah that brings more than thirty U.S. officials, military officers, scientists, and journalists on the record about unidentified anomalous phenomena (UAP). Frequently asked
- What is The Age of Disclosure?
- A 2025 documentary directed by Dan Farah that premiered at South by Southwest on March 9, 2025. It features more than thirty named U.S. officials, military personnel, scientists, and journalists speaking on the record about unidentified anomalous phenomena (UAP).
- Who is the director?
- Dan Farah — a producer best known for the 2018 film *Ready Player One*, who turned to documentary work for The Age of Disclosure after several years of pre-production interviews with intelligence-community sources.
